Ernest was born to the late Irvin Ledet and Dorothy Provost Ledet on August 10, 1948, in Cade. At an early age, his family moved to New Iberia. He entered into eternal rest on December 29, 2017.

Ernest, affectionately called “Bo-Boy” by family and close friends, was educated in the schools of Iberia Parish. He was a graduate of Jonas Henderson High School. In 1968, he joined the United States Marines where he served honorably, including a tour in Vietnam.

On December 28, 1974, Ernest was united in holy matrimony to Sandra Gaines. Two daughters and one son were born to this union. He became a devoted father and vowed to care and protect his family.

Ernest loved spending time with family and friends. His sense of humor kept others laughing. He loved watching old westerns on television. His grandson Zavier was the joy of his life. He enjoyed playing with him and attending all of his sporting events and other activities.
